柯林斯词典
- VERB 低估;轻视;小看
If youundervaluesomething or someone, you fail to recognize how valuable or important they are.- We must never undervalue freedom...
我们决不能低估自由的价值。 - Many companies deal with their female employees in a way that undervalues them.
许多公司轻视女员工。
